Output 83d20782519fb937286c680f24f7132a9dfd7d85f301458ab03f5dd3b266548d:0

value
324430585
script pubkey
OP_0 OP_PUSHBYTES_20 90da3c2598ef131b36d0288fa96b6b2a8d57d50e
address
ltc1qjrdrcfvcauf3kdks9z86j6mt92x404gwj3fq8q
transaction
83d20782519fb937286c680f24f7132a9dfd7d85f301458ab03f5dd3b266548d
spent
true